What Will You Do?
- Oversee global month-end and year-end close processes across multiple entities and jurisdictions to ensure consistency, accuracy, and timeliness
- Develop, maintain, and enhance scalable financial controls and operational processes to support continued international growth
- Drive standardization of accounting policies and procedures across global entities
- Manage relationships with external auditors, tax advisors, banking partners, and regulatory agencies
- Enhance ERP systems, reporting tools, and financial workflows to improve efficiency and reporting capabilities
- Lead, mentor, and develop accounting and finance team members across multiple geographies
- Ensure proper documentation and maintenance of accounting records, policies, and internal procedures
- Collaborate cross-functionally with HR, legal, operations, and business leadership on strategic and operational initiatives
- Identify opportunities to leverage AI, automation, and data analytics to improve reporting accuracy and operational efficiency
